Welcome to our most recent signatories! (Update # 1)

What a wonderful response the Statement of Trans-Inclusive Feminism and Womanism is getting–it’s only been up for a few hours, and already we’ve received about 60 more signatories!  We began by trying to integrate the new names into the existing list in alphabetical order…but quickly realized that we just wouldn’t be able to keep up with the requests if we did that, so we’ll put up a post every day or two with the most recent signatories listed as long as signatures keep coming in.

We’re really delighted by every single person or organization who wishes to sign.  Feminism and womanism can and should welcome trans* people.
